The Real Cost of In-Home Care in Winchester, MA: A 2025 Guide

TL;DR: Key Cost TakeawaysIn-home care rates in the Winchester area for 2025 typically range from $40 to $50+ per hour, depending on the level of care (companion vs. personal). This is often more affordable than the average monthly cost of assisted living (approx. $6,800+), especially when starting with part-time care. Most families use private pay (savings/assets), Long-Term Care Insurance, or VA Benefits to fund care, as Medicare generally does not cover non-medical home care services. How to Talk to Your Aging Parent in Cambridge About Getting Help

In a Rush? Here’s a Quick Summary The key to a successful conversation about care is approaching it as a loving, collaborative process. Prepare Thoughtfully: Choose a calm, private setting. Speak with siblings beforehand to present a united front, and gather specific, gentle examples of your concerns. Communicate with Care: Use "I" statements to express your feelings ("I'm worried when...") instead of accusatory "You" statements. Frame help as a tool to preserve their independence at home. A Winchester Resident's Guide to Local Senior Care Resources

TL;DR: Your Winchester Senior Resource Quicklist Feeling pressed for time? Here are the essential resources this guide covers for Winchester families. The Jenks Center (Winchester Council on Aging): The central hub for social, wellness, transportation, and educational programs for seniors. In-Home Care (Non-Medical vs. Medical): Understanding the crucial difference between daily living support (like FirstLight Home Care provides) and skilled nursing care. Local Support Services: Key information on the B-Line bus service for senior transportation and local Meals on Wheels programs for nutrition.
